The Victory Group Harare Christian Soccer League match day 14 took place at the weekend around Harare.
JCC retained top spot after a convincing 4-0 win over UPRM at Greendale Sports Club.
ZAOGA also grabbed its second consecutive win for the first time with a 3-1 away win over AFM & SOD in a match played at UZ.
The match between second-placed NLCC and HCC was postponed over unfavourable pitch conditions.
JCC head coach, Never Muparutsa expressed satisfaction with the result.
“The win feels good. We are trying to keep the boys on course and try aim for the championship. The boys are raring to go and we are in good spirit. We are hoping that we keep winning putting the pressure to those behind us.
“As far as we are concerned we are happy both the players and the coaching department. We are playing according to our plan and vision. We displayed very good football and I would want to appreciate all other teams that are giving us good competition in the league. We also wish them the best.”
The UPRM manager, Tendayi Tandi said they are not reading much into the defeat.
“We take every game as it comes. Since we are building we might have to knock off a few bricks hence losing some points but the structure will be stronger and bigger at the end.
“We had a great game even though we lost, most of our first team players have crossed over the Limpopo and some are currently trying out for division 1 clubs like Karoi United.
“We held our own until half time only to crumble due to some injury inspired substitutions. Playing the log leaders was never going to be a stroll in the park.”
“They were not as good as we expected and being my favourites to win the league they have to pull up their sock a bit to win it. About us we just have to build for next season by winning all our last 5 games.”
